Reinvent public libraries as effective e-Learning, Career Counselling Centres: LG

Srinagar: In a big choice geared toward reworking the Public Libraries in J&Ok by leveraging expertise, Lt Governor, Shri Manoj Sinha in the present day gave the go-ahead to the Department of Libraries and Research to modernize its Public Libraries within the UT with requisite IT infrastructure and reinvent these important establishments as productive e-Learning-cum-Career Counselling Centres for youth.

Chairing a evaluate assembly of the Department of Culture right here this afternoon, the Lt Governor stated that this novel initiative might be achieved by pooling assets from Mission Youth, J&Ok and the Smart City Mission to ascertain the requisite infrastructure within the present community of round 130 public libraries in J&Ok.

He stated this technological intervention would assist construct a collaborative and futuristic digital library system within the UT and unlock wide-ranging assets in conventional public libraries for a brand new technology of learners and start-ups, enabling free, long-term, public entry to the data and expertise.

Pertinently, as part of this initiative, the Department of Libraries has, in convergence with Jammu Smart City Ltd (JSCL), already began intensive upgradation of SRS Central Library Jammu to rework it right into a full-fledged Digital Library with very best technological amenities.

The key elements of the Rs 4.30 crores, SRS Library Jammu upgradation challenge embrace establishing of IT Hub with a devoted Server and Nodes, CCTV Surveillance System, Access Control System, RFID Tagging of Books and Access, set up of 150 KVA Genset, Air-Conditioning System, Fire Protection System, Furniture, Reading Lamps, Water Dispensers with RO Connection, Softscaping, Bookshelves, Toilet Block, Cafeteria, Screenwalls, Vertical Garden and so forth.

The same proposal has been despatched by the Libraries Department to the Srinagar Smart City Ltd (SSCL) for upgradation of SPS Library Srinagar as a Digital Library which is witnessing an enormous foot-fall of eager readers, particularly youth in its Reading Rooms.
